KNOXVILLE, Tenn. (AP) — When No. 6 Georgia clawed its way back from three deficits against No. 15 Tennessee on Saturday, coach Kirby Smart got the answer he was looking for.
“We feel our team has a certain identity,” Smart said after the Bulldogs’ 44-41 overtime victory. “We’re not going to go down without a fight.”
